Polished Steel: Aesthetic Excellence with Maintenance Considerations

Polished steel undergoes mechanical or chemical processes to create a smooth, reflective surface finish. This treatment is primarily aesthetic but also offers functional benefits including easier cleaning and reduced surface contamination risk.

Industry Standard Options: Polishing levels typically range from #4 brushed finish (satin appearance) to #8 mirror finish (highly reflective). The choice depends on application requirements and budget constraints. For B2B buyers on Alibaba.com, #4 finish is most common for industrial equipment, while #8 mirror finish commands premium pricing for decorative and architectural applications.

Cost Consideration: Polished steel typically costs 15-30% more than untreated steel, with mirror finishes at the higher end of this range. However, polished surfaces do not provide inherent corrosion protection—additional treatments may be required for outdoor or harsh environment applications.

Applicable Scenarios: Polished steel excels in food processing equipment, medical devices, architectural features, and consumer products where appearance matters. However, it is not suitable for outdoor construction, marine environments, or applications requiring long-term corrosion resistance without additional protective layers.

Galvanized Steel: Corrosion Protection Workhorse for Demanding Environments

Galvanized steel features a protective zinc coating applied through hot-dip galvanizing or electro-galvanizing processes. The zinc acts as a sacrificial anode, corroding preferentially to protect the underlying steel—a mechanism that provides exceptional long-term corrosion resistance.

Longevity: Hot-dip galvanized steel can provide 20-50 years of corrosion protection depending on environmental conditions. Rural environments offer the longest service life, while marine and industrial atmospheres reduce longevity but still outperform untreated steel significantly [6].

Limitations to Consider: Galvanized steel is not ideal for applications requiring specific colors (zinc coating is silver-gray), food contact without additional treatment (zinc can react with acidic foods), or welding after galvanizing (heat damages the coating). Buyers needing color customization typically opt for coated alternatives.

Coated Steel (Powder & Paint): Balancing Protection with Customization

Coated steel encompasses various surface treatments including powder coating, liquid paint, and specialized polymer coatings. These treatments provide both corrosion protection and aesthetic customization—critical factors for consumer-facing products and branded equipment.

Powder Coating vs. Liquid Paint: Powder coating has become the preferred choice for B2B applications due to superior durability, environmental benefits (no VOC emissions), and thicker application without runs or sags. Typical powder coating thickness ranges from 60-120 microns, compared to 20-40 microns for liquid paint [4].

Durability: Quality powder-coated steel products typically maintain appearance and protection for 15-25 years in moderate environments. Premium coatings with UV stabilizers extend service life for outdoor applications [4].

Color & Branding Advantages: Unlike galvanized steel's uniform silver-gray appearance, coated steel offers unlimited color options—critical for brand consistency, safety color-coding, and architectural specifications. This customization capability commands premium pricing in B2B markets.

Cost-Benefit Analysis: Coated steel typically costs 20-40% more than galvanized steel but offers superior aesthetics and comparable corrosion protection. For consumer products, architectural applications, and branded equipment, the premium is often justified by enhanced market appeal.

Small Batch vs. Large Volume Considerations:

For small batch orders (under 500 units), coated steel offers flexibility with lower minimum order quantities and faster turnaround. Galvanized steel typically requires larger batches to justify setup costs, though some suppliers offer consolidated orders from multiple buyers.

For large volume orders (5,000+ units), galvanized steel becomes more cost-competitive due to economies of scale in hot-dip galvanizing operations. Coated steel remains viable for projects requiring color customization regardless of volume.

Common Pitfalls and Risk Mitigation Strategies

Based on buyer feedback and industry analysis, several recurring issues affect surface treatment procurement. Understanding these pitfalls enables proactive risk mitigation.

1. Coating Thickness Variance: The most common complaint involves coating thickness not matching specifications. Galvanized coatings specified at 80 microns may arrive at 40-50 microns without proper verification.

Mitigation: Require coating thickness certificates with each shipment. For critical applications, engage third-party inspection services before shipment. Alibaba.com's Trade Assurance provides additional protection for verified specifications.

2. Environmental Mismatch: Products specified for indoor use may fail prematurely in outdoor or marine environments. Polished steel without additional protection is particularly vulnerable.

Mitigation: Clearly document intended application environment in product specifications. Offer multiple treatment options with clear performance guidelines for each environment type.

3. Food Safety Concerns: Galvanized steel can react with acidic foods, and some coatings may not meet food-contact regulations. This affects food processing equipment, kitchenware, and agricultural applications involving edible crops.

Mitigation: Obtain and provide food-grade certifications (FDA, LFGB, etc.) for relevant products. Clearly label products not suitable for food contact.
